I am using the Debian ooffice package which reports as OOO310m11 build 9399

I am trying to repeat some headers at the top of each printed page.  I select
Ranges->Edit->Rows to Repeat and use the roll-up box to select the first two
rows, which puts $1:$2 in the field and turns the pulldown to "user defined"

However, it then constantly pops up a dialog box saying "invalid sheet 
reference".
